Cooper-Sorrells Funeral Home was founded in 1938 in Honey Grove, Texas and has always been family owned and operated. In 1946 Cooper-Sorrells Funeral Home was established in Bonham, Texas and in 1995 Cooper-Sorrells Funeral Homes were purchased by Gerald and Judy Howard of Bonham. Upon retirement, in 2024, Gerald sold the business to Bryan Frazier and Dwain Kirby, both long time Funeral Director's with Cooper-Sorrells. Ronald Andrew Rhudy, age 74 of Bonham passed from this life and entered his eternal home on Friday, December 5, 2025. Born July 10, 1951, in Bonham to W.A. “Dub” and Laura Harper Rhudy. Ronnie was a lifelong member of New Zion Baptist Church. He attended Ector School where he graduated in 1969. On November 5, 2005, Ronnie married his best friend, Barbara McBride Rhudy, with whom he shared 20 years of companionship, laughter and devotion. Ronnie was a true cowboy at heart. He enjoyed ranching and found joy spending his time with Barbara and their cattle and horses on their small ranch. Right out of high school, Ronnie started his working career at Voluntary Purchasing Group where he spent several years on the road as a long haul truckdriver. He then retired from the City of Denison as Parks and Recreation Superintendent after 26 years of service. After retirement, Ronnie served two 4-year terms as Fannin County Commissioner Pct 1 and also served as County Tax Assessor Collector. He finished his career with the county as a truckdriver for Precinct 3 in Honey Grove where he retired again in December 2024. Ronnie was known overall for his dedication and reliability.

He was preceded in death by his parents, W.A. “Dub” and Laura Rhudy and his beloved grandparents, Clarence and Minnie Harper of Savoy. Ronne is survived by his wife Barbara; sister Sharon Moore of Ector; Brother Kenneth Rhudy and Cathy of Ector; Brother Joe Rhudy and Becky of Dodd City and numerous nieces and nephews and extended family. His family, along with many friends and loved ones will remember him for his loyalty, kindness and unwavering work ethic.

Those who knew Ronnie will forever carry with them the memory of a good man – a sharp dressed cowboy who lived life with integrity, grit and a gentle spirit. Those serving as pallbearers are Jarod Rhudy, Cole Rhudy, Justin Rhudy, Russ Shields, Adam McBride, Kolby Bruhn, Jon Akins and Jaxon Butler. Honorary Pallbearers: Dewey Gorden, Ray Gibbs, Steve Edwards, Gailen Todd, Jerry Magness, James Rhudy, Doug Olds and Stan Barker. Funeral services under the direction of Cooper Sorrells Funeral Home of Bonham, Texas will be held at the Bois D’ Arc Creek Cowboy Church, 3375 S. Hwy 121, Bonham on Tuesday, December 9 at 2 p.m. Services delivered by Bro. Kevin Lane. Visitation will be on Monday, December 8th at Cooper Sorrells Funeral Home from 6 p.m. to 8 p.m. Burial will follow at Sunnyside Cemetery in Savoy, Texas.
